Title: Materials Data on ReTeS by Materials Project

ReTeS crystallizes in the cubic F-43m space group. The structure is three-dimensional. Re4+ is bonded in a 6-coordinate geometry to three equivalent Te2- and three equivalent S2- atoms. All Re–Te bond lengths are 2.83 Å. All Re–S bond lengths are 2.35 Å. Te2- is bonded in a distorted trigonal non-coplanar geometry to three equivalent Re4+ atoms. S2- is bonded in a 12-coordinate geometry to three equivalent Re4+ atoms.
